Thesis

Market participants often ignore local structural levels in high-volatility 'noisy' environments. By quantifying 'Market Weather' (turbulence) and only entering when price exhibits low-cross stability and high statistical drift (ADM), we can isolate breakouts with a higher probability of follow-through. The edge resides in the transition from low-turbulence consolidation to statistically significant drift.
